#e74898 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e74898 is composed of 90.6% red, 28.2%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 34.2%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 329.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 59.4%. #e74898 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#cf0031.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#e74898 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e74898 has RGB values of R:231, G:72,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.34,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15157400.

Shades and Tints of #e74898
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080104 is the darkest color, while #fef5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e74898
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9098 is the less saturated color, while #ff3098 is the most saturated one.
